Summary

CVE-2026-35192 is a low-severity Use of Persistent Cookies Containing Sensitive Information (CWE-539) vulnerability in Djangoproject Django. Its CVSS base score is 2.3 (Low).

Operationally, exploitation aligns with the MITRE ATT&CK technique Steal Web Session Cookie (T1539); ranked at the 43th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

Vulnerability Data

An issue was discovered in 6.0 before 6.0.5 and 5.2 before 5.2.14. Response headers do not vary on cookies if a session is not modified, but `SESSION_SAVE_EVERY_REQUEST` is `True`. A remote attacker can steal a user's session after that user…

more

visits a cached public page. Earlier, unsupported Django series (such as 5.0.x, 4.1.x, and 3.2.x) were not evaluated and may also be affected. Django would like to thank Cantina for reporting this issue.
